Patterns of Exclusion

It is important to consider the ways in which sexual dynamics can lead to exclusion within social networks at work. One common pattern that emerges from research on this topic is that those who do not conform to socially acceptable gender roles may be excluded from certain networks or denied access to important resources.

Women may find themselves excluded from professional networking events or denied promotions if they do not adhere to traditional feminine norms such as being passive and submissive. Similarly, men who display characteristics traditionally associated with femininity, such as empathy or vulnerability, may also face exclusion.

The Role of Power Dynamics

Another factor that shapes patterns of inclusion and exclusion based on sexual dynamics is power dynamics. Research shows that those with more power tend to have greater control over which individuals they include in their networks and which ones they exclude. This means that people in positions of authority, such as managers or executives, can use their influence to exclude those they deem undesirable while including those they see as valuable. This dynamic has been particularly pronounced in industries where there is a high level of gender segregation, such as technology or finance.
